And, you know, I think a lot of focus gets into the Mycotoxins part just because of what it does to the body.
I mean, these chemicals are so harmful, they can directly damage your brain, your neurons, your respiratory tract. But mold allergy is actually far more common.
Mold Allergy vs Mycotoxin Illness 3:35
And you can have both problems and clinically, the symptoms of mycotoxins the and mold allergy can overlap. I mean, as a patient and you and I as doctors, we would have a hard time distinguishing if someone's actually having an allergic reaction to a mold spore or are they having a chemical effect of the mycotoxins. And my experience is such that a lot of people who've been in water damaged buildings have had that mycotoxins exposure. More often than not, they get sensitized to mold spores. So now every time they go out on a humid day in Austin, you know, when the humidity is high, the mold spores are very high.
You know, people feel those symptoms. They feel the head pressure, they feel the brain fog, they feel the congestion. They feel that tightness in their chest and they go, wait a second. You know, I know that my home has problems. I should feel better when I'm outside or I should feel when I get better when I go to a different environment and they don't necessarily feel better. Why is that? Well, again, any time there's mold spores in the air, that can be an immune trigger to set the immune system off.
So, you know, I want to really emphasize that mold allergy is incredibly common. And what complicates this a bit further, if you go to the doctor and you get tested for mold, allergy, you know, when we think about allergy as a whole, we typically think about these reactions that are mediated by immunoglobulinE or IGE and that IGE molecule is ultimately what binds to mast cells. The mast cells, you know, pop their balloon, release all their granules, including histamine and about 200 other chemicals.
And that's what triggers a lot of the symptoms. But in the case of mold, a lot of mold Allergy doesn't involve IGE at all. And therefore, if you go to the allergist, you get skin prick testing, or if you do a blood test called a RAST test RSV, you might find that there's no IGE antibodies. And so the doctor says, well, you're not allergic to mold spores. And you go, Yeah, okay. But every time I go into a damp basement, every time it rains, every time I'm in hot, humid weather, I feel the effects of it.
And that's sort of a clinical indication that, you know, you're probably allergic to mold spores. So sometimes, you know, we have to do different times of testing to help identify if somebody is having allergy to mold. You know, maybe it's IgG, maybe it's T cell mediated. But when we find that people do have that reaction and we start implementing immunotherapy again, I find a lot of my patients do really well with it. So, you know, I'm an environmental medicine doctor by training, so we'll use different types of skin techniques. No one's called serial endpoint titration where when you go to a regular allergist, they just put a needle in your skin and you'll put a little bit of the antigen and you just see if you get a histamine reaction.
Well, in serial endpoint titration, you can actually start injecting different it's a little intradermal injection in you do different dilutions and sometimes you might find one dilution doesn't provoke a reaction, but a stronger dilution does. So it's a far more accurate method of helping identify that sensitivity because, you know, even between different mold species, there can be different sensitivities. You could be highly allergic to Aspergillus and maybe not so much to cloud as barium. So because there's so many different mold species out there in the world, you know, you have to look at them kind of as individuals.
I think we want to kind of lump it all together. And again, when you look at what's available through blood testing like RAST testing or even what the allergist does with skin prick testing, they might do the top four or five molds that are common, but there's dozens of mold species that can provoke reactions. So it may also be a function that they're just not looking at the right stuff. So is it they're not looking at the right stuff? Is it just it's a different immune mechanism. So I find is a much more reliable method for identifying mold.

Yeah. So well, maybe just let me give you an overview of immunotherapy as a whole. I think that that might set the stage. So in our practice, there's really three types of immunotherapy that we use. I won't really talk much about allergy shots. That's what a conventional allergist would do. So again, if you do the skin prick testing, they find out you're allergic to dust or ragweed. You come in every week, they inject you with dust and ragweed. And over time they keep building the concentration as your tolerance gets better.
And then you eventually get to a point where you're kind of at a maintenance dose, and that's what you stay on often for many, many years. And that's what a conventional ours does, and that's pretty much it. But the other options we have is ones called sublingual immunotherapy. Sublingual means under your tongue. So the concept is very much like allergy shots, and the testing we do can be very similar. Again, we could do skin protesting, we could do blood testing, we could do testing. And based on that, we will compile, you know, whatever allergens we need in a bottle.
And instead of injecting it, you just put these drops under your tongue. The way all immunotherapy works, at least with regards to allergy, is through these cells called dendritic cells. And dendritic cells are part of your immune system and they are in your skin, which is why allergies like to do the injections. But they're also very rich in your mouth and under your tongue. So whether you put that allergen under your tongue or inject it to your skin, the mechanism is really the same. It's just another way to to confer immunity through those dendritic cells.
So, you know, again, what we don't really understand is like, well, wait a second. This is the thing that bothers me. This is the thing that's a trigger. Why on earth can I injected or put it on my tongue? And it doesn't make me worse. If you can figure that out, please let me know. We'll win the Nobel Prize in medicine together. All we know is that at the right concentration, at the very specific concentration, instead of your immune system overreacting, it starts to get retrained to not react.
So, you know, the the power and this is really the dose, the concentration. And, you know, because everyone's individual, it gives us a lot of flexibility to play around with that dose, to play around with that concentration, to find out exactly what you need. Now, when we do serial endpoint titration, we find out exactly what dose someone needs to neutralize their immune system. So we're looking for that neutralizing dose that's going to start blocking that immune response. And then again, over time, we keep increasing that dose as we feel like people's immune system tolerates.
So sublingual immunotherapy we can do for, you know, mold and pollen and animals and chemicals and other things. The only time we don't really do sublingual immunotherapy is we don't do it for people that have legitimate anaphylactic food reactions. It's just there's very little research out there on that specific case. There is a potential to trigger the reaction because we are putting it under the tongue. So there's different ways of dealing with that. But pretty much any other type of like food sensitivity, the ones that are nuisances but aren't dangerous, then sublingual immunotherapy works really well.
The other thing you can. Do it at home rather than running into that. Right? So it gives people that flexibility that you do it at home. Again, it's very safe. There are literally over a thousand studies on sublingual immunotherapy. This has been used for over 100 years. It's widely used throughout Europe. Actually. They've done studies looking at the cost of allergy shots and the cost of sublingual immunotherapy. Sublingual immunotherapy is literally a quarter of the cost of doing allergy shots.
And since most of Europe is socialized medicine, they want to save money, but the United States allergist get reimbursed for doing allergy shots. And so again, it's just a great tool to have The other type of immunotherapy that I think is really neat is called Elda Low Dose Allergy Therapy, and LDA was actually developed in the 1960s by a doctor out of the UK. He was an EMT surgeon, Dr. Len McEwen, and he really discovered by accident, and I won't go into the whole story that if you really dilute out these antigens a lot way more than what conventional allergies do, and you mix it with an enzyme called beta glucan on a day, and this enzyme's naturally found in your white blood cells.
That combination seems to help modulate your immune system again, about whatever you mix with that enzyme. And so, you know, again, he started treating people for food allergies and environmental allergies.
Sublingual Immunotherapy and LDA 22:05
And with LDA, the way it's traditionally taught is you do it as a intradermal injection. So it just goes between the layers of the skin. But what's neat is that you only get a dose every seven weeks. So unlike allergy shots that start as weekly or even sublingual, that's daily, this you only get every seven weeks. And what we've kind of learned over time is, again, for the mechanism already described, you know, you can put it under the tongue as well. So the downside to the shot is it really stings.
I've had it done. It's like getting stung by 100 bees. It's not very comfortable. It only lasts about 30 seconds, but it's. Just that because of the beta click, you're on it. Maybe. You know, I don't know if it's the enzyme or the extract or a little bit of both. But, you know, you only put just a tiny amount in. But that little tiny amount really doesn't feel very good. But, you know, this is the way it's been done for 60 years. It's very effective. But in our practice, we've kind of migrated. A lot of our patients are just doing it under the tongue.
Get I read a lot of kids in my practice. They would never tolerate the injection, the sting would hurt too much and they would never come back and see me. And clinically we find that the tongue works again really well for a lot of people. And the fact, again, that you only need it every seven weeks for people who are so used to taking so many supplements and pills daily, this is pretty nice that basically it's almost every two months. So you say even with the sublingual, they only need it every seven weeks.
With LDA? Yeah, with lda it's every seven weeks. So really the big difference, the goal is exactly the same. Again, we're just trying to build immune tolerance to these different allergens. So with LDA, there are, there's technically four mixes, there's two different food mixes. It's the same number of foods, but they're in slightly different concentrations. There's an inhalant mix which has mold and pollen and cat and dust and dog and feather and pretty much anything you breathe in. And then there's also a chemical mix.
So it's got formaldehyde in petroleum in a lot of the common things that that trigger people. And of course, you and I work with so many people who are not only mold sensitive, but chemically sensitive and again, you go to the allergist and say, I'm chemically sensitive. You know, they're going to look at you like you got three heads and go, okay, so here's a way, again that we can actually treat people for those chemical sensitivities to those those different triggers. So, you know, we start people usually with the lower dose of the food mix, the inhalants and the chemicals, again, every seven weeks.
And then after they've had a few doses, we can move them up and give them the stronger food mix. And is there a mold next for it to sorry, is there also a mold mix? So the mold mixes in the inhale and exhale. It's okay. Yeah. So the idea behind LDA and with LDA, there's really no testing involved or it doesn't have to be involved. And the idea behind it is know the food mix has about 70 different foods in it. The inhalant mix is about the same, and the chemical mix is only about four or five different chemicals.
But, you know, if you're there's something in that mix that you're allergic or sensitive to, you know, we're covering the bases. And if you're not allergic or sensitive to it, who cares because you're not allergic or sensitive. So we're not going to harm you by giving you something in that mix that you're not reacting to. That's a low dose because it's such a it's exactly still okay. Yeah. So, you know, I like this therapy again. The fact that it's been around for 60 plus years, it's got a long clinical use.
Unfortunately, there's no real research on this. You know, there's no money to be made by doing large scale studies. But now that we've got, you know, hundreds, if not thousands of doctors around the world of uses therapy for 60 years, again, very, very safe, very well tolerated. So I like this for people who maybe can't do sublingual immunotherapy for whatever reason. I like this for kids just because it's safe, It's really convenient. And again, it's not something you have to do every day. So, you know, this is just the conversation we have with our patients on, you know, what fits your world best.
What do we think is going to be the best option? And the nice thing, too, is that, you know, we're not married to any one thing. If we start down one path and we don't feel like we're getting the kind of results we want, we have these other options to try. So how long does it take for people to start to notice a difference after starting the treatment? That's a great question and everyone's different. My experience with sublingual immunotherapy as a whole, most people start to feel the difference somewhere between four and eight weeks after starting treatment, we start to see something change.
With LDA, it can be a little different sometimes. It's not really until the third or fourth dose that people feel the difference. So it could be six months, eight months or longer. So that's really kind of the big distinguishing things that I tell people about between LDA and Sublingual immunotherapy is time. You know, sublingual immunotherapy for most people does work a lot faster. It's just there's a little bit more involved because you need to go through the process of testing. This is something you need to do daily for most people where LDA is like, well, we don't really need to test you.
It's just based on your history and you only need us every seven weeks. And what about cost between the two options? So there's a little bit more upfront costs with sublingual because you need the testing. You know, we got to find out what your reactive to. So you know with and fortunately insurance doesn't pay for that of course so that's an out-of-pocket expense. But once we've done the testing we've established what your sense of two we don't really have to go back and keep redoing all that testing.
So that's sort of a one time upfront expense. And then the cost of sublingual immunotherapy versus LDA, it really kind of depends on how many things you're allergic are sensitive to. With sublingual immunotherapy, we can mix certain things together in the same bottle and other things we really can't. All of these extracts have enzymes in it, and if you mix the wrong things, they kind of degrade themselves in the bottle and they sort of weaken themselves. So like if you're allergic to ten pollens, I can put all the pollens together in one bottle.
If you're allergic to eight molds, I can put all my molds together. But we don't mix mold and pollen. I don't mix pollen and dust. I don't mix dust in food. So if you've got a lot of sensitivities, you can have four or five, six, seven bottles. That's going to be a lot more expensive than just doing lda. But if you only have, you know, a couple of things, you've only got two bottles or three bottles, the cost may be kind of a wash. Okay, that's super helpful.
